Description

Job Title: RN - Labor & Delivery
Facility: Banner - North Colorado Medical Center
Shift: Nights, 7:00 PM – 7:30 AM (36-hour schedule, 24 hours guaranteed)
Start Date: 24/11/2025
Assignment Length: 13 weeks
Weekly Stipend: $412.23
Weekly Taxable Pay: $625.34
Scheduled End Date: 23/02/2026

Certifications and Licenses Required:

  • Valid Registered Nurse (RN) License in the State of Colorado (Must be current and active).
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) Certification (Must be current).
  •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) Certification (Highly preferred).
  • NRP Certification (Preferred; required for Labor & Delivery).

What You Bring:

  • Proven experience in Labor & Delivery nursing, with the ability to handle high-acuity cases.
  • Strong clinical skills in maternity and postpartum care, including fetal monitoring and emergency response.
  • Ability to float to different units within the facility where you are experienced, demonstrating flexibility and adaptability.
  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ills, ensuring quality patient care in a fast-paced environment.
  • Valid Colorado RN license, along with current BLS, ACLS, and NRP certifications.

Preferred Education & Experience:

  • Education: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) or Associate Degree in Nursing (ADN) from an accredited program.
  • Experience: Minimum of 2 years of recent Labor & Delivery nursing experience; experience in a hospital setting preferred.
  • Experience with high-risk obstetric cases, fetal monitoring, and emergency obstetrics procedures is highly advantageous.

Additional Details:

  • Shift Details: Night shift hours, providing an opportunity for a stable overnight schedule.
  • Guaranteed Hours: 24 hours per week, with Banner's policy to cancel only 1 shift per week, offering consistent income stability.
  • Flexibility: Willingness to float to other units within the facility where you have experience is required, supporting staffing needs across departments.
  • Location Flexibility: Will accept your willingness to work in any available units or campuses as specified.
  • Start ASAP – Immediate availability preferred to meet urgent staffing needs.

About Greeley, CO

As a Travel Labor and Delivery Nurse in Greeley, CO here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Lower than the national average
Weather
  • Average summer highs of 85°F and lows of 55°F.
  • Average winter highs of 44°F and lows of 17°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als are available and relatively easy to find.
Transportation
  • Car friendly with easy access to major highways.
  • Limited public transportation options.
Demographics
  • Diverse population with a mix of age ranges.
  • Common health issues may include allergies due to the agricultural surroundings.
  • There is a growing population of travel nurses.
Things to Do
  • Plenty of restaurants offering diverse cuisines, local art scene, live music venues, various outdoor activities including hiking and biking, and community sports events.
